About Robert F Levendosky

Robert F Levendosky is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Plant Science and Infectious Diseases, having authored 9 papers that have together received 329 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Genomics and Chromatin Dynamics (9 papers), R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(3 papers) and R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Molecular Biology (321 citations), Structural Biology (5 citations) and Biophysics (8 citations). Robert F Levendosky has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Sweden and India. Frequent co-authors include Gregory D. Bowman, Anton Sabantsev, Sebastian Deindl, Ilana M. Nodelman, Ashok Kumar Patel, Xiaowei Zhuang, Srinivas Chakravarthy, Yupeng Qiu, Sua Myong and Ren Ren. Their work appears in journ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Nucleic Acids Research and Nature Communications.
